Bitwise Sees Bitcoin at Deep Discount Levels as ETF Outflows and Fear Hit Extremes
According to Bitwise's latest Weekly Crypto Market Compass, Bitcoin's price slump driven by heavy crypto ETP outflows and widespread futures liquidations has pushed key valuation metrics into rarely seen discount territory. The report notes that BTC briefly dropped to about $74,700, with nearly 78% of invested capital estimated to be underwater, while sentiment and positioning indicators suggest an increasingly contrarian setup for the broader crypto market.

CryptoQuant CEO Says Bitcoin’s Chance Of A 70% Drawdown Hinges On MicroStrategy’s Next Move
In a Feb. 1 analysis, CryptoQuant CEO Ki Young Ju argued that Bitcoin’s recent decline is driven by persistent selling pressure and a lack of new capital, as signaled by a flat Realized Cap and weakening liquidity. He said a full-cycle style 70% crash would likely require MicroStrategy to shift from aggressive accumulation to substantial selling, while other on-chain data from CryptoQuant contributors show stablecoin market growth has reversed since December and exchange inflows have faded. At press time, BTC was trading at $78,280 amid what Ki expects could become a broad sideways consolidation phase rather than an immediate capitulation.
